Representing the sensory experience of landscape, fauna and climate, this anthropological essay about border crossings explores the harrowing journeys of undocumented migrants crossing the inhospitable and arid Sonoran Desert—a strategic point of passage located between Mexico and the USA.
Combining chilling audio interviews and 16mm images of the Sonoran Desert, this engrossing documentary offers a damning portrait of the U.S. and Mexico border crisis. From directors Joshua Bonnetta and J.P. Sniadecki, El mar la mar_ is an immersive portrait of the conditions endured by migrants.
